Numbness, tingling, and balance problems are not something to ignore.
Peripheral neuropathy often starts small — maybe your feet feel “off,” you stumble more often, or you notice you have to look down when walking. These changes can happen when the nerves in your feet stop sending clear signals to your brain.
When those signals are weak or scrambled, your body may struggle with stability, coordination, and confidence while moving.
The earlier you pay attention to these signs, the better. Neuropathy care focuses on improving circulation, supporting nerve function, and helping your body rebuild better communication between your feet and brain.
